Latest rates of all carats:
Today afternoon, a big change was seen in the rate of gold in the bullion market. Here are the rates of gold of different purities:
999 purity (24 carat): ₹86089 per 10 grams 📈
995 purity (23 carat): ₹85744 per tola 📈
916 purity (22 carat): ₹78958 per tola 📈
750 purity (18 carat): ₹64567 per tola 📈
585 purity (14 carat): ₹50362 per 10 grams 📈

Silver has also become expensive! 🥈
Not just gold, the prices of silver are also skyrocketing. Today, the price of silver has also jumped drastically. Silver of 999 purity has reached ₹ 97464 per kg, which was earlier ₹ 95549. This means that buying silver has also become expensive now. 😲
